LOCATION The picturesque village of Scorton is home to a number of local amenities, including two public houses, a doctors surgery, tea rooms, nursery, village shop and post office. It also has bus routes that can take you to other nearby towns such as Richmond and Darlington. It is the home of the Scorton Feast, an anually held event located on the raised village green which hosts a wide range of different activities. Located with easy access to the A1, as well as being only a few miles from the market town of Richmond.
